Fuel scarcity: Tiwa reveals she’s leaving Nigeria

Popular Nigerian songstress, Tiwa Savage has lamented over the fuel scarcity which resurfaced due to President Bola Tinubu’s announcement of the removal of subsidy.

During his Inauguration speech on May 29, Tinubu said that subsidy will cease to exist under his administration.

Shortly after, fuel queues began at filling stations, and some started hoarding their petrol.

Tiwa Savage who just returned from Brazil where she went for holiday, took to her social media page to speak on how the fuel scarcity and other issues are frustrating her.

The ‘All Over’ singer said she came back home to fuel scarcity and epileptic power supply.

She also bemoaned the damage to one of her car tyres due to a bad road.

The ‘Koroba’ crooner also said that she will stay off social media and start making preparations to go back to Brazil because of the hardship in Nigeria.

Taking to her Instastory, Tiwa wrote; “Literally less than an hour back in Naija and one of my car tyres gone. Other car now in the queue for fuel. Issue with electricity in my house.

“I’m logging off and going back to where I came from because…”
